Chemistry Check For Mature Singles

If you feel a spark, pause to see whether the connection can support a real relationship. Attraction is a great start, but for mature singles it helps to check alignment on practical and emotional dimensions early so you avoid mismatched expectations later.

Start With Values And Life Priorities
Ask what matters most now: family relationships, career rhythms, health routines, financial approaches, or caregiving responsibilities. Share your own priorities and listen for dealmakers (shared core beliefs) and dealbreakers (nonnegotiables). It’s okay if priorities differ — what matters is whether you can accommodate each other’s choices.

Talk About Relationship Goals
Be direct but gentle about what you want: companionship, long-term partnership, casual dating, or something else. People’s goals can change over time, so frame the conversation as a check-in rather than a final judgment. Look for similar timelines and openness about future plans.

Discuss Lifestyle Fit
Compare daily routines, social habits, travel desires, and living arrangements. If one of you loves quiet evenings and the other prefers frequent nights out, outline compromises you’re willing to try. Practical details—sleep schedule, pet preferences, willingness to relocate—often carry more weight than initial chemistry.

Explore Communication Style And Conflict
Ask how they like to handle disagreements and what they need to feel heard. Mature relationships benefit from clear expectations about frequency of contact, comfort with emotional topics, and preferred ways to give feedback. Try a small honest conversation early to see how both of you respond.

Set And Respect Boundaries
Share your boundaries around time, privacy, finances, and family involvement. Encourage the other person to state theirs. Respecting boundaries builds trust quickly and shows whether you can create a safe, sustainable partnership.

Questions To Try On A First Few Dates

  • What does a typical weekend look like for you these days?
  • What are three values you try to live by?
  • How do you like to spend free time—quiet hobbies, social activities, travel?
  • What are you looking for in a relationship right now?
  • How do you usually handle plans or disagreements when they come up?

Keep questions open, curious, and nonjudgmental. Chemistry is meaningful, but pairing it with clarity about values, goals, and daily life will help you decide whether this spark can turn into something steady and satisfying. Dating Confidence Reset

If online dating has left you tired, invisible, or unsure, start with a small reset that puts your needs and boundaries first.

Clarify Your Intention

Decide what you want from Mingle2 right now: casual chats, new friends, or exploring something serious. Write a short sentence that captures this and use it to guide who you message and how you describe yourself. When your aim is clear, it’s easier to spot matches that deserve your time and to let go of interactions that don’t.

Pace Conversations With Purpose

  • Open with one or two friendly questions that invite a real answer instead of yes/no replies.
  • Allow a few messages back and forth before sharing personal details or setting a phone call; pace, not pressure, builds comfort.
  • If a conversation stalls, try a gentle new topic or step back—you don’t need to force a connection.

Set Realistic Expectations

Remember that most exchanges are exploratory. Not every chat will become a date, and that’s normal. Treat each interaction as information: you learn about your preferences and what you’ll accept in future matches.

Notice Small Wins

  1. Celebrate clear, kind replies and conversations that feel easy rather than perfect.
  2. Track patterns: who responds thoughtfully, who shares similar values, and what profile details attract better matches.
  3. Use those wins to refine your search and your profile—small adjustments compound into better outcomes.

Choose Matches Thoughtfully

Prioritize profiles that show shared interests or communication style over those that only check boxes. Trust your instincts: if something feels off or you aren’t excited to respond, it’s okay to move on. Respectful declines keep your time and emotional energy available for better fits.

Keep Emotional Steadiness

Limit time on the app when you’re feeling low, and take breaks without guilt. When rejection happens, reframe it as a mismatch rather than a reflection of your worth. Stay curious about what each interaction teaches you, and come back when you feel rested and intentional.
